5 Facts About Monica Rambeau, the Next Captain Marvel

Monica Rambeau is also Captain Marvel in the comic book. Find out some of her facts here.

Before the airing of WandaVision, Marvel Studios announced actress Teyonah Parris will play adult Monica Rambeau. And in the fourth episode of WandaVison, Monica Rambeau’s identity is finally revealed. In the previous episodes, she shows up as “Geraldine” in the sitcom world made by Wanda.

Monica Rambeau is the daughter of Carol Danvers’s friend, Maria Rambeau, who appeared in the Captain Marvel film. In the series, adult Maria joins Sentient Weapon Observation Response Division (S.W.O.R.D.), an organization formed by her mother and also her workplace.

Her background is different from the Monica Rambeau in the comic book. In the Captain Marvel comic book, Monica was a police officer. Until one day she was exposed to extradimensional energy from a weapon belonging to a mad scientist. She then used her power to fight crimes. And Monica is later known as Captain Marvel.

Fans have predicted that Marvel Studios prepared a different background for Monica Rambeau in MCU leading up to her donning the Captain Marvel suit. But before we get to that point here are some facts about Monica.

1. Many Nicknames

Monica Rambeau has a lot of nicknames in the comic book. Some of them are Captain Marvel, Aunt Monica, Avengers Mom when she leads the Nextwave group, The Lady Light, Photon, Pulsar, Spectrum, and Sun Goddess.

2. Monica’s Background

Monica was born and raised in New Orleans, Louisiana. She is the daughter of Maria Rambeau, a fighter pilot, and Frank Rambeau, a firefighter. Monica spends her youth with her mom. When she is an adult, Monica joins the police force. But one event changed her fate because she obtained a superpower after being exposed to extradimensional energy from a weapon created by a mad scientist.

3. One of the Marvel Divas

In 2009, Marvel Comics releases a comic book about a group of female superheroes named Marvel Divas. Monica Rambeau is one of the members alongside Firestar, Black Cat, and Hellcat. But in that group, Monica is called Photon, not Captain America.

4. Joins Avengers

After getting her superpower, Monica meets Spider-Man who introduced her to Avengers. She then joins the group. She is not just a member of the group because she was also made a leader.

Monica willingly take off the Captain Marvel title and changed it to Photon. The title was given to Genis-Vell, Captain Marvel’s real son. Sadly, after being called Photon, the name was also taken by Genis-Vell who obtained a new power. Monica then changed her name to Pulsar.

5. Amazing Superpower

In the comic book, Monica Rambeau is one of the female superheroes with amazing power. She was considered by Captain America (Sam Wilson) and Tony Stark. Monica Rambeau’s power in the comic book includes Energy Form, Appearance Alteration, Flight, Superhuman Speed, Intangibility, Invisibility, Energy Duplication, Energy Absorption, Energy Blasts, Hyper-Cosmic Awareness, and even Eidetic Memory.
